As part of the PorscheFest Drivers' Education weekend at Summit Point Raceway on Saturday, July 31, 2021, PCA Potomac will hold our annual LAPS FOR CHARITY event.  During the afternoon, at approximately 5:30 p.m., individuals will be able to drive their own cars around the Summit Point track behind a pace car.  You'll be able to see the entire track from the best vantage point: the driver's seat, just like the racers!

PCA Potomac appreciates your participation in our Community Service program and we hope you enjoy your opportunity to drive/ride on a professional race track.  100% of your donation will go to Rallye for Vets.  See their website (https://rallyeforvets.org/) for more information.

For a minimum $20 donation (per car), participants will get about 15 minutes on the track behind pace cars.  Any type of vehicle (car, truck, SUV) is welcome, provided that the driver and each passenger have operational seat belts.  No helmets or other safety equipment are required.  These are parade laps, so no racing or passing will be allowed.

Your minimum donation will be handled through this online registration form. If you wish to contribute more, bring cash or check to the track. Please arrive at the classrooms in the main paddock of Summit Point Raceway by 4:30 p.m., where we will check that you have completed the SpeedWaiver and have a short meeting.  Grid up time starts shortly after the final DE run group is released onto the track, at approximately 5:00 p.m.
